About AI Training Work
AI training is the human side of building artificial intelligence. Experts create examples, review model-generated work, and provide clear feedback so AI systems can learn to solve real problems more accurately. In this role, your computational mathematics and coding expertise will help evaluate how AI agents handle complex technical work.
